Groundskeeper Jobs in New Hampshire
A Groundskeeper in the landscaping industry plays an integral role in maintaining the aesthetic and functional aspects of outdoor spaces. They are responsible for a wide variety of tasks which may include mowing lawns, pruning trees and shrubs, fertilizing plants, maintaining irrigation systems, and removing waste and litter. They also assist in diagnosing and treating plant diseases and pests, ensuring the health and vitality of all flora within their care. Additionally, they may assist with landscape design and installation, providing input based on their extensive knowledge of plant care and growth requirements.
As for skills and certifications, proficient groundskeepers should possess a strong knowledge of horticulture and landscaping techniques. Some positions may require a certification or degree in horticulture, landscaping, or a related field. Essential skills include physical stamina, attention to detail, creativity, problem-solving abilities, and the capacity to operate and maintain various types of landscaping equipment. Prior to becoming a Groundskeeper, a person may have roles such as a Landscaping Laborer, a Nursery Assistant, or a Garden Center Employee. These jobs offer valuable hands-on experience and understanding of plants and outdoor maintenance, serving as stepping stones towards a Groundskeeper position.
